5.3.5 Load Inertia
The larger the load inertia becomes, the worse the movement response of the load. The
size of the load inertia (J
L
) allowable when using a servomotor must not exceed five times
the motor inertia (J
M
).
If the load inertia exceeds five times the motor inertia, an overvoltage alarm may arise
during deceleration. To prevent this, take one of the following actions:
• Reduce the torque limit value.
• Reduce the slope of the deceleration curve.
• Reduce the maximum motor speed.
• Consult your Yaskawa representative.
